Output 45255257e0ef35f2184412554afd0b6ad9db32f86f1faaad00500c6182e98db9:0

value
900500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a66936912904e9de3d9bd589ece6118306d719d OP_EQUAL
address
35ZDBhBqMzCsdVayKgjaQfnqh9TYypAAL2
transaction
45255257e0ef35f2184412554afd0b6ad9db32f86f1faaad00500c6182e98db9
confirmations
307525
spent
true